WebIn Division III, there are 444 institutions and more than 170,000 student-athletes. A key difference in Division III is that there are no athletic scholarships. However, a majority of the athletes are on some form of academic or need-based aid. Also, there are shorter practice hours and less travel for games in D III. WebHow many D2 and D3 schools are there? The Distinction Between College Division Levels The NCAA lists 351 Division I institutions, 308 Division II colleges, and 443 Division III schools. WebDec 20, 2024 · Division II schools have a mean undergraduate enrollment of 2,514 and one in 11 students at a Division II school is typically an athlete. The athletic eligibility standards for Division II schools are slightly less stringent than Division I schools. There are still 16 required high school courses, but the courses are a bit more flexible. WebThere are about 300 schools and thousands of students who participate in Division II sports. Division II schools offer athletic scholarships, but there is less athletic aid available in Division II than in Division I. Division III schools do not offer athletics scholarships. However, 75 percent of student-athletes receive some form of merit or need-based financial aid. Are Division 3 sports worth it? Division 3 athletics are not full of mediocre players. The players are very good and the competition is great. hierarchy of medieval life pyramid
